What is the HEX Code and RGB Value for the Pale Blush Color?
The Pale Blush color is represented by the HEX code #dfafa4, and its RGB equivalent is RGB(223, 175, 164). These values are widely used in web design and digital media to ensure accurate color representation across different platforms.

How is Pale Blush color described in the HSL model?
In the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) model, Pale Blush is represented by a hue of 11°, saturation of 48%, and lightness of 76%. This model is primarily used in graphic design software to modify the lightness or color richness, helping designers achieve the perfect balance of brightness and intensity for their projects.
How does Pale Blush behave in the HSV model?
In the HSV model, Pale Blush color is represented by hue 11°, saturation 26%, and value 87%.

What is the difference between shades and tones of Pale Blush?
Shades of Pale Blush are created by adding black to the base color, resulting in a darker appearance, whereas tones are achieved by adding gray, making the color more muted.
